Former My Chemical Romance guitarist Ray Toro launches website, shares demos

Ray Toro, former guitarist of My Chemical Romance, is back! Toro just launched a website, which prominently features an announcement that he will be entering the studio to record with producer Doug McKean (also the producer of Gerard Way's Hesitant Alien) next week. Ray Toro (ex-My Chemical Romance) posts new song, "Isn't That Something"

Former My Chemical Romance lead guitarist Ray Toro has posted a new song titled “Isn't That Something.” Toro recorded and performed everything himself in true DIY fashion, as he mentions in the tweet below.
